Get a full strategic breakdown of AutoNation’s market position, competitive intensity, and external threats—all in one powerful analysis.\u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\u003cdiv class=\"container_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"text-section text-1_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"frst_big_letter_heading\"\u003e\n \u003ch2\u003e\n\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_letter green\"\u003eS\u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_text\"\u003euppliers Bargaining Power\u003c\/span\u003e\n\u003c\/h2\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-wrapper green\"\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Suppliers-Box-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eSupplier concentration is moderate\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eThe automotive retail sector depends on a complex supply chain. AutoNation's suppliers, including major automakers, have moderate bargaining power. This concentration allows suppliers to potentially dictate terms. In 2024, the top 3 automakers controlled about 50% of the US market, affecting AutoNation's margins.\u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Suppliers-Box-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eComponent standardization exists\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eStandardization of automotive components significantly impacts AutoNation's supplier bargaining power. Because many parts are uniform, AutoNation can choose from various suppliers. This competition gives AutoNation more negotiating power. For example, in 2024, AutoNation's parts and service revenue reached $7.8 billion, showcasing their ability to manage costs effectively through supplier choices.\u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"image-section image-1_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Suppliers-Image.svg\" alt=\"Explore a Preview\"\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Suppliers-Box-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eSwitching costs are significant\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eSwitching suppliers is a complex issue for AutoNation. AutoNation faces pressure to offer competitive prices and incentives to draw buyers. This limits the company's ability to set higher prices, increasing buyer power. In 2024, the average transaction price for a new vehicle was around $48,000, highlighting the importance of price in consumer decisions.\u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Customers-Cart-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eMany dealer choices available\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eCustomers in the automotive market enjoy significant bargaining power due to the wide selection of dealerships and vehicle brands. New Vehicle Price: ~$48,000\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003c\/tr\u003e\n \u003ctr\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eSwitching Costs\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eLow, facilitating easy comparison\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eDealerships Compared: Avg. 3\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003c\/tr\u003e\n \u003ctr\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eInformation Availability\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eHigh, enabling informed negotiation\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eOnline Research: \u0026gt;50% before visit\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003c\/tr\u003e\n \u003ctr\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eFinancing Options\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eEmpowering, fostering rate comparison\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eNew Car Loan Rate: ~7%\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003c\/tr\u003e\n \u003c\/tbody\u003e\n \u003c\/table\u003e\n \u003cbutton class=\"get_full_prdct_green\" onclick=\"get_full()\"\u003e\u003c\/button\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\u003cdiv class=\"container_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"text-section text-1_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"frst_big_letter_heading\"\u003e\n \u003ch2\u003e\n\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_letter green\"\u003eR\u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_text\"\u003eivalry Among Competitors\u003c\/span\u003e\n\u003c\/h2\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-wrapper orange\"\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Rivalry-Chart-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eIntense competition among retailers\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eThe automotive retail market is fiercely competitive, with AutoNation contending against major dealership groups and local independents. This intense rivalry squeezes pricing and profit margins. For instance, in 2024, AutoNation's gross profit per vehicle retailed was approximately $5,500, reflecting the pricing pressures. The competition necessitates strategic initiatives to maintain market share.\u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Rivalry-Chart-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eConsolidation trend in the industry\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eThe automotive retail sector is seeing a consolidation wave, with major groups buying smaller dealerships. This boosts competition because bigger players get more market share and can save money. AutoNation needs to adjust to keep its competitive advantage. In 2024, the top 10 dealer groups controlled over 25% of U.S. new vehicle sales.\u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"image-section image-1_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Rivalry-Image.svg\" alt=\"Explore a Preview\"\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Rivalry-Chart-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eAdvertising and marketing expenses are high\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eAutoNation faces intense competition, necessitating significant investments in advertising and marketing to attract customers. Gross Profit\/Vehicle\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003e$5,500\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eReflects Pricing Pressure\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003c\/tr\u003e\n \u003ctr\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eTop 10 Dealer Groups Market Share\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eOver 25%\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eHighlights Consolidation\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003c\/tr\u003e\n \u003ctr\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eOnline Car Sales Market Share\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003e~10%\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eShows E-commerce Growth\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003c\/tr\u003e\n \u003c\/tbody\u003e\n \u003c\/table\u003e\n \u003cbutton class=\"get_full_prdct_orange\" onclick=\"get_full()\"\u003e\u003c\/button\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\u003cdiv class=\"container_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"text-section text-2_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"frst_big_letter_heading\"\u003e\n \u003ch2\u003e\n\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_letter orange\"\u003eS\u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_text\"\u003eSubstitutes Threaten\u003c\/span\u003e\n\u003c\/h2\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-wrapper orange\"\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Substitutes-Arrows-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eUsed car market poses a threat\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eThe used car market presents a formidable substitute for AutoNation's new car sales. Consumers often choose used vehicles to reduce costs, which directly affects new car sales volume. In 2024, used car sales are projected to reach 40.5 million units, demonstrating a significant alternative. The availability and condition of used cars, like those offered at CarMax, further influence this substitution threat. \u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Substitutes-Arrows-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003ePublic transportation alternatives exist\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003ePublic transportation presents a threat to AutoNation. Leasing, with its lower payments, directly competes with purchases.\u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003ctable class=\"tbl_prdct orange_head blur_tbl\"\u003e\n \u003cthead\u003e\n \u003ctr\u003e\n \u003cth\u003eSubstitute\u003c\/th\u003e\n \u003cth\u003eImpact on AutoNation\u003c\/th\u003e\n \u003cth\u003e2024 Data\u003c\/th\u003e\n \u003c\/tr\u003e\n \u003c\/thead\u003e\n \u003ctbody\u003e\n \u003ctr\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eUsed Cars\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eReduced new car sales\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003e40.5M units sold\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003c\/tr\u003e\n \u003ctr\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003ePublic Transit\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eLower vehicle demand\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eRidership rebound\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003c\/tr\u003e\n \u003ctr\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eRide-Sharing\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eDecreased personal vehicle demand\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003eMillions of users\u003c\/td\u003e\n \u003c\/tr\u003e\n \u003c\/tbody\u003e\n \u003c\/table\u003e\n \u003cbutton class=\"get_full_prdct_green\" onclick=\"get_full()\"\u003e\u003c\/button\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\u003cdiv class=\"container_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"text-section text-1_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"frst_big_letter_heading\"\u003e\n \u003ch2\u003e\n\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_letter green\"\u003eE\u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_text\"\u003entrants Threaten\u003c\/span\u003e\n\u003c\/h2\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-wrapper green\"\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Entrants-Lamp-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eHigh capital investment required\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eEntering the automotive retail market demands substantial capital, like land, facilities, and inventory. High initial costs deter new competitors, lessening the threat. AutoNation's established infrastructure, and resources provide a competitive advantage. In 2024, AutoNation reported over $27 billion in revenue, highlighting its financial strength.\u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Entrants-Lamp-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eEstablished brand loyalty is a barrier\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eAutoNation benefits from established brand loyalty, a significant barrier for new entrants. For instance, in Q3 2024, AutoNation reported a gross profit of $1.7 billion.\u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"image-section image-1_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Entrants-Image.svg\" alt=\"Explore a Preview\"\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Entrants-Lamp-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eFranchise agreements limit entry\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eFranchise agreements with automakers restrict new dealerships. These agreements make it tough for new players to get vehicles. AutoNation's franchise network shields it from new competitors. In 2024, the U.S. auto retail market was valued at over $1.3 trillion, highlighting the stakes.\u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"product-green-section\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"product-box-green-section4\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"title-row-green-section\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Entrants-Lamp-Icon-Color-2.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eEconomies of scale are important\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"content-row-green-section blur_box\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eEconomies of scale are vital in the automotive retail sector, impacting the threat of new entrants.
